Infinity Lithium recently completed a scoping study valuing a future operation at the San Jose Lithium Project in Spain at up to US$1.017 billion.
Notably, the operation would include the production of battery grade lithium hydroxide.
The study envisions a fully integrated hard rock lithium project from mining to battery-grade production of lithium hydroxide.
